In the last stint, VER used more throttle in the high-speed corners... yet he was slower there! How?! 🤔

More loaded wing➡️More drag➡️Lower entry speed! Lifting less was not enough to compensate for this, but he did exit with the same speed as NOR.

His top speed was lower, too. 📉

Norris was pushing 100% to try to catch him: McL's tyre wear and empty-tank pace was unmatched.

The data refers to Lap 63 (the last lap before both drivers increased their laptimes), but this trend is observed throughout the last stint.

Which team has the longest (or shortest) gear ratios?🤔
I've estimated them to compare them! 💡

Mercedes: shortest gear ratios from gear V onwards
Red Bull Racing: longest gears from IV onwards

Gear ratios are fixed for the season: same PU, yet different ratios for McL and Merc.

As F1 Engines have a very flat power curve (due to the mandated flow limit), gear ratios from II to VII are chosen based mainly on corner-exit drivability.

For a given engine, a longer VIII gear suggests that the team expects less drag.

Ready for the first ‘High-altitude’ track of 2024? 👀

700m above sea level ➡️ 7% lower air density ➡️ ~7% less drag and downforce!

Teams will try to claw back that downforce loss through medium-load wings (despite the long straights: power is crucial).

The lower air density will make having high drag slightly less penalizing, and having high downforce even more important: teams with higher drag (Alpine, possibly McL) should gain from that, while Haas’ low drag will be less useful there.

Alpine’s lower engine power might hurt them on the frequent straights.

Softest compounds (C3-C5)

In Spain, the teams with the LOWEST average top speeds in qualifying (McL and RedBull, despite their tows) had the BEST performance💡

Ferrari: highest top speed, but suffered in the high-speed corners due to lower downforce⚠️

NOR's tow was worth 2km/h, VER's 4km/h

Ferrari seems determined to run a less loaded wing in Austria, too (2nd image): let's see if it will work better here! 🛠

Tyre degradation was extremely high today, even taking into account the fact that Pirelli brought their softest compounds here (C3-C5).

Despite that, the Medium was actually a better tyre than the Hard, as the latter had similar durability at the expense of grip.
